Subject: Incremental rebuilds are live on Petalwork Docs

Hey folks — welcome aboard! Quick heads-up for new teammates: the site no longer does full rebuilds on every merge. We now hash content per page and only regenerate what changed, so typical publishes drop from ~12 minutes to under one. If a page looks stale, trigger a manual full rebuild from the Orchard panel. The first incremental build to go out is referenced below.

build token for tawip-yageg: htk9_92ac43d42

Handover — Vexler partner SFTP drop

Ownership moves to you today. Drop runs hourly from Vexler's end into the intake bucket via the relay host. Watch for zero-byte files; their exporter flakes on Mondays. Creds live in the ops vault, path noted in the runbook. Vault auto-seals after 48h idle. Support escalations go to the on-call rotation, not me. If the vault is sealed when you need it, unseal with the recovery passphrase below.

recovery phrase for tadug-fafof: zorwyn-kasion

Runbook: idempotency keys on Payvane retries. Every charge attempt from the Ledgerock gateway carries an idempotency key derived from order ID plus attempt window. If a customer reports a double charge, do not refund immediately — first check whether both attempts share the same key. Matching keys mean the second charge was rejected upstream and will auto-void within 24 hours. Only escalate to the billing desk if the keys differ. Reference the trace token recorded just below when escalating.

trace token, fafog-kageg: htk4_98e6

Hey — handing over the Gustrel fan-out service before I roll off. It takes alerts from the Merrow weather feed and fans them out to regional subscriber queues. Mostly boring, but the retry logic gets spicy during storm season, so keep an eye on queue depth alarms. Docs are thin; the code in fanout/dispatch.go is the real source of truth. For reference, here's the config it currently runs with.

config for kafof-bawef:
holath:
  log_level: debug
  metrics_host: metrics.holath.qorvelsys.internal
  pin: 2191
  pool_size: 32